Axon
A long, slender projection of a nerve cell, or neuron, that typically conducts electrical impulses away from the neuron's cell body.
Homeostasis
The process by which living organisms regulate their internal environment to maintain stable, optimal conditions despite changes in the external environment.
Vital Activities
Essential processes or actions necessary for the maintenance of life, including breathing, feeding, digestion, and reproduction among organisms.
Autonomic Nervous System
The part of the nervous system responsible for controlling bodily functions not consciously directed, such as breathing, the heartbeat, and digestive processes.
